开发此类金融科技应用的核心在于构建一套基于大数据的智能风控系统,通过多维度的替代数据评估用户信用,从而在合规的前提下实现精准授信,构建不需要征信的贷款app正规平台的技术重点,并非绕过监管,而是利用先进的技术手段挖掘用户在其他维度的信用价值,确保业务流程的透明性、安全性与高可用性。

系统架构设计原则
为了保证平台在高并发场景下的稳定性与数据安全性,开发架构必须遵循微服务设计思想,将业务逻辑与风控引擎解耦。
-
前后端分离架构
- 前端:采用React Native或Flutter开发跨平台App,确保iOS与Android端体验一致,UI设计需简洁明了,重点突出借款进度与还款计划。
- 后端:使用Spring Cloud或Go-Zero搭建微服务集群,核心服务包括用户服务、订单服务、支付网关服务及核心的风控决策引擎服务。
-
数据库分库分表
- 用户数据与订单数据量巨大,需采用MySQL分库分表策略,按用户ID取模分片,提升查询效率。
- 使用Redis集群缓存热点数据,如用户登录态、额度信息、风控黑名单,降低数据库压力。
-
高可用与容灾
- 核心服务部署需至少保证双活,利用Kubernetes (K8s) 进行容器化编排,实现自动扩缩容。
- 建立多级缓存机制与熔断降级策略,防止非核心服务故障影响核心借款流程。
大数据风控引擎开发
这是平台的核心竞争力,也是替代传统征信报告的关键技术模块,风控引擎需要采集、清洗、分析海量数据,输出最终的信用评分。
-
多维数据采集接入
- 设备指纹:集成第三方SDK(如腾讯云或小鸟云的设备指纹),采集设备IMEI、MAC地址、IP归属地、安装应用列表等,识别欺诈设备。
- 运营商数据:在用户授权前提下,通过三网API接口获取运营商话费账单、在网时长、实名认证信息,评估用户稳定性。
- 行为数据:记录用户在App内的点击流、填写资料的时长、浏览习惯,分析用户是否存在机器操作或异常行为。
-
特征工程构建

- 基础特征:年龄、性别、职业、居住地稳定性。
- 衍生特征:计算用户最近3个月的平均通话时长、深夜通话频率、常用联系人信用度(需脱敏处理)。
- 序列特征:分析用户App使用的时间序列,识别异常的规律性行为。
-
模型训练与部署
- 使用Python (Pandas, Scikit-learn) 进行数据预处理。
- 采用逻辑回归(LR)、XGBoost或LightGBM算法训练二分类模型(违约/正常)。
- 将训练好的模型通过PMML或ONNX格式部署到风控服务中,实现毫秒级实时评分。
核心业务流程实现
业务逻辑的严谨性直接关系到资金安全与合规性,需严格按照标准化的借贷流程开发。
-
用户注册与实名认证(KYC)
- 流程:手机号验证 -> OCR识别身份证 -> 人脸活体检测 -> 要素核验。
- 技术点:接入公安部CTID数据库进行实名认证,确保“人证合一”,使用小鸟云或百度云的活体检测SDK,防止照片攻击。
-
授信审批流程
- 步骤1:用户提交借款申请,系统触发风控引擎。
- 步骤2:风控引擎返回评分与建议额度。
- 步骤3:若评分通过,进入人工审核环节(或自动审核),最终确定额度与费率。
- 代码逻辑:
Function ApplyLoan(UserID, Amount): RiskScore = RiskEngine.GetScore(UserID) If RiskScore > Threshold: Return AuditResult(PASS, LimitAmount) Else: Return AuditResult(REJECT, "综合评分不足")
-
资金划拨与还款
- 支付通道:接入银联或网联渠道,实现用户银行卡快捷支付。
- 对账系统:开发定时任务,每日与银行渠道进行流水对账,确保账务一致。
- 代扣逻辑:在还款日触发自动代扣,支持失败重试机制,并生成催收任务列表。
安全合规与隐私保护
正规平台必须将数据安全与合规性作为开发的最高优先级,严格遵守《个人信息保护法》及相关金融监管规定。
-
数据加密存储

- 传输加密:全站强制启用HTTPS (TLS 1.2+),防止中间人攻击。
- 存储加密:用户身份证号、手机号、银行卡号等敏感信息,必须使用AES-256算法加密存储,密钥与数据分离管理(KMS)。
-
隐私合规控制
- 授权机制:所有数据采集(通讯录、定位、相册)必须遵循“最小必要原则”,并在隐私协议中明确告知,获取用户显式授权。
- 数据脱敏:在日志打印与前端展示时,对敏感信息进行掩码处理(如:138****1234)。
-
反欺诈策略
- IP限制:限制同一IP在短时间内的频繁申请请求,防止攻击。
- 黑名单机制:建立行业共享的黑名单数据库,自动拦截有欺诈历史的用户。
- 关联图谱:构建知识图谱,分析用户之间的社交关系,识别团伙欺诈风险。
性能优化与监控
-
接口性能优化
- 核心接口响应时间控制在200ms以内。
- 使用消息队列处理耗时操作(如发送短信、生成合同),避免阻塞主线程。
-
全链路监控
- 接入Prometheus + Grafana监控系统资源(CPU、内存、JVM)。
- 使用ELK (Elasticsearch, Logstash, Kibana) 收集分析业务日志,快速定位异常。
- 埋点追踪用户行为漏斗,分析转化率流失点,持续优化产品体验。
通过上述严谨的系统架构、智能的风控模型以及严格的合规开发流程,可以构建出一个技术先进、安全可靠且体验良好的金融科技产品,这种技术路线不仅满足了市场对高效借贷的需求,更在底层逻辑上保障了平台的正规性与长久运营能力。






